The Business Analyst (internally known as Data Detectives) will partner with leadership to provide actionable insight to help improve both the top and bottom-line results. The Business Analyst will be a subject matter expert in data modeling and solutions, analysis, and business intelligence. The Business Analyst will help drive business results, improve customer effectiveness, and operational efficiencies. The Business Analyst will perform thought partner, and strategic advisor, for Parts Town’s leaders and provide insight and recommendations to drive decision making.

The salary range for this role is $87,137.34 - $117,595.06 annually which is based on including but not limited to qualifications, experience, and geographical location. Parts Town is a pay for performance-company. In addition to base pay, some roles offer a profit-sharing program, and an annual bonus depending on the role. Our comprehensive benefits package includes health, dental and vision insurance, 401(k) with match, employee assistance programs, paid time off, paid sick time off, paid holidays, paid parental leave, and professional development opportunities.
